实现"mysql query use show where"的步骤和代码解释

在实现"mysql query use show where"这个功能之前,我们首先需要了解一下整个过程的流程。下面是一个表格,展示了每一步需要做什么:

步骤 动作
步骤1 连接到MySQL数据库
步骤2 选择要使用的数据库
步骤3 使用SHOW TABLES语句显示数据库中的表
步骤4 使用SHOW COLUMNS语句显示表中的列
步骤5 使用SELECT语句查询表中的数据

接下来,让我们一步一步来实现这个功能。

步骤1:连接到MySQL数据库

为了连接到MySQL数据库,我们可以使用以下代码:

import mysql.connector

# 创建数据库连接
m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  password="yourpassword"
)

# 打印连接成功的消息
print(mydb)

这段代码使用了mysql.connector模块来建立与数据库的连接。你需要替换yourusernameyourpassword为你自己的用户名和密码。打印语句会输出一个成功连接的信息。

步骤2:选择要使用的数据库

在连接成功后,我们需要选择要使用的数据库。使用以下代码可以实现这一步骤:

# 选择数据库
mycursor = mydb.cursor()
mycursor.execute("USE yourdatabase")

这段代码使用了USE语句来选择要使用的数据库。你需要将yourdatabase替换为你自己的数据库名称。

步骤3:使用SHOW TABLES语句显示数据库中的表

现在我们已经选择了要使用的数据库,接下来我们可以使用SHOW TABLES语句来显示数据库中的表格。以下是代码示例:

# 显示数据库中的表格
mycursor.execute("SHOW TABLES")

# 遍历结果并打印每个表格的名称
for table in mycursor:
  print(table)

这段代码使用了SHOW TABLES语句来获取数据库中的所有表格的名称。然后,我们使用一个循环来遍历结果,并打印每个表格的名称。

步骤4:使用SHOW COLUMNS语句显示表中的列

在我们选择了要查询的表格后,我们可以使用SHOW COLUMNS语句来显示表格中的列。以下是代码示例:

# 显示表格中的列
mycursor.execute("SHOW COLUMNS FROM yourtable")

# 遍历结果并打印每个列的名称
for column in mycursor:
  print(column[0])

这段代码使用了SHOW COLUMNS语句来获取表格中的所有列的名称。同样地,我们使用一个循环来遍历结果,并打印每个列的名称。你需要将yourtable替换为你要查询的表格的名称。

步骤5:使用SELECT语句查询表中的数据

最后一步是使用SELECT语句来查询表格中的数据。以下是代码示例:

# 查询表格中的数据
mycursor.execute("SELECT * FROM yourtable")

# 打印查询结果
for row in mycursor:
  print(row)

这段代码使用了SELECT语句来查询表格中的所有数据。我们使用一个循环来遍历结果,并打印每一行的数据。同样地,你需要将yourtable替换为你要查询的表格的名称。

以上就是实现"mysql query use show where"功能的步骤和代码解释。通过按照这些步骤一步一步地实践,你应该能够成功地查询MySQL数据库中的数据。祝你好运!

甘特图

下面是一个使用甘特图展示整个过程的示例:

gantt
    title 实现"mysql query use show where"的步骤

    section 连接到MySQL数据库
    步骤1: 2022-01-01, 1d

    section 选择要使用的数据库
    步骤2: 2022-01-02, 1d

    section 使用SHOW TABLES